Property Description for 150 E Harreld Road Marion, IN 46952

Let this home wow you with its stunning blend of country charm and modern amenities! Situated on nearly 5 acres not far from town, this bi-level gem features 3 bedrooms and 2.5 baths, including a master suite with a brand-new bathroom and walk-in closet, both completed in 2023. The open living space offers a beautifully done kitchen with slow-close cabinets, new countertops, and striking dark tile flooring. Enjoy the serenity of the lovely patio accessed through Anderson sliding glass doors, or cozy up by the pellet stove in the sunlit living room. The remodeled family room is perfect for entertaining and includes ample storage. With a detached 2-car garage featuring its own electric panel and concrete floors, and additional amenities like a half bath and laundry room on the main level, this home truly offers the best of both worlds.
